Abstract: 
Funding information is one of the pillars of the research information ecosystem. Despite this, it is still very challenging to associate scientific outputs to all the entities that financially support a project and all the stakeholders involved. To tackle this, PTCRIS – a national integrated research information management ecosystem - developed a new infrastructure to support the management of attributed funding to the scientific triad in the Portuguese scientific ecosystem: organizations, people and projects. The SciPROJ database is the new national database that aggregates funding records (national and international) that support science and technology activities carried out in Portugal.
